Marks, Mississippi

Marks, Mississippi, in Quitman county, is 63 miles S of Memphis, Tennessee. There are an estimated 1,551 people in the city.

The People and Families of Marks

In Marks, about 33% of adults are married. Though there are lots of families, Marks isn't one of those places where everyone is married. Single people can feel at home there.

The city has a larger percentage of females than most places.

Wealth and Education

In 2000, Marks had a median family income of $27,153.

Political Inclinations

In the 2004 race for President, George W. Bush was the top recipient of campaign contributions ($1,500) in Marks. Party contributions tended to flow to the Republican team.

Marks Housing

Approximately 67% of housing in Marks is owner-occupied. Tax haters might appreciate the relatively low real estate taxes in the city.

Commuting

In Marks, 93% of commuters drive to work.
